We are seeking a highly motivated and talented individual to join our AI team as an Intern. This internship opportunity is designed for students or recent graduates who are passionate and eager to explore and learn the latest advancements in the field of AI. As an intern, you will work closely with our experienced researchers, engineers, and product managers, gaining hands-on experience in AI research, algorithm development, and data analysis.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with the product and research team in designing, implementing, and evaluating novel AI software modules
  • Solve complex problems in the medical device/imaging sector.
  • Build prototypes and proof-of-concept implementations for potential applications of AI technologies in medical products.
  • Maintain clear and comprehensive documentation of research findings, experimental setups, and codebase.
  • Work collaboratively with other team members, participate in team meetings, and contribute to research discussions.
  • Implement visualisation techniques to interpret and analyse the outputs of AI models.
  • Visualising model predictions and probability maps, offering valuable insights into the model's decision-making process and its strengths and weaknesses.
  • Design interactive visualisation tools that allow researchers and stakeholders to explore and interact with data and model outputs efficiently. These tools should facilitate the exploration of AI model performance and provide a means for comparing different models and experiments.

Qualifications:

  • Currently pursuing a Bachelor's, Master's, or Ph.D. degree in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, or related fields, with a focus on computer vision and machine learning.
  • Strong programming skills in Python, and familiarity with deep learning frameworks such as TensorFlow or PyTorch.
  • Solid understanding of Neural Network concepts, especially Convolutional Neural Networks (CNN) and probability and statistics.
  • Experience with relevant libraries and tools commonly used in AI research.
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ving abilities.
  • Effective communication skills and ability to work in a team-oriented environment.
  • Prior research experience in AI (academic or personal projects) is a plus.
